If your Nokia phone is stuck in a bootloop, frozen on the Android logo, or locked out by a forgotten password/pattern, the ADB interface will not work. You must use Fastboot mode instead. Step 1: Boot into Fastboot Mode Manually Turn off your Nokia device completely.
